Metal cladding replacement services involve removing existing exterior metal panels and installing new ones to enhance both the appearance and functionality of a building’s facade. This process typically includes assessing the current cladding condition,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the new panels to ensure a secure and durable fit. The service may also involve inspecting underlying structures for any damage or issues that need to be addressed before the new cladding is applied, helping to ensure the longevity of the exterior.
One of the primary benefits of metal cladding replacement is its ability to resolve issues related to weather damage, corrosion, or deterioration over time. Metal panels can become compromised due to exposure to harsh elements, leading to leaks, rust, or structural weaknesses. Replacing the cladding can restore the building’s exterior integrity, prevent further damage, and impro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and weather resistance.

Material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ing metal cladding typically ranges from $8 to $20 per square foot, depending on the material type and complexity of the project. For example, a 1,000-square-foot building might cost between $8,000 and $20,000. Prices vary based on material choices and installation requ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for metal cladding replacement gener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project price. This can translate to roughly $4,000 to $14,000 for a standard-sized building, depending on local labor rates and project scope. Costs may fluctuate based on accessibility and site conditions.
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as permits, scaffolding, or structural repairs can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more to the overall cost. These fees depend on local regulations and the specific needs of the building undergoing replacement. It is advisable to get detailed quotes from local service providers.
Cost Variability Factors - Overall costs for metal cladding replacement can vary significantly based on material quality, building size, and complexity. Smaller projects might start around $5,000, while larger or more intricate jobs could exceed $30,000. Consulting with local contractors can provide more prec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
